对PyFileSystem2的WebDAV支持

fs.webdavfs的Python项目详细描述


网络论坛

fs.webdavfs是PyFileSystem2的WebDAV驱动程序。

支持的python版本

  • python 2.7版
  • Python3.5
  • python 3.6
  • Python3.7

使用量

fs.open_fs方法与webdav://协议一起使用:

>>>importfs>>>handle=fs.open_fs('webdav://admin:admin@zopyx.com:22082/exist/webdav/db')

或者使用WebDAVFS类的公共构造函数:

>>>fromwebdavfs.webdavfsimportWebDAVFS>>>url='http://zopyx.com:22082'>>>root='/exist/webdav/db'>>>handle=WebDAVFS(url,login='admin',password='admin',root)>>>handle.makedir('foo')>>>print(handle.listdir('.'))....

对于https上的webdav,您可以将webdav://与端口443一起使用

>>>handle=fs.open_fs('webdav://admin:admin@zopyx.com:443/exist/webdav/db')

webdavs://

>>>handle=fs.open_fs('webdavs://admin:admin@zopyx.com/exist/webdav/db')

作者和贡献者

  • 尤里·霍米亚科夫
  • 塞米恩·盖沃龙斯基
  • Andreas Jung
  • Martin Larralde

许可证

这个模块是在麻省理工学院的许可下发布的。

本单元由Andreas Jung/Zopyx赞助和资助

接触

andreas jung/zopyx
亨兹卡普夫林33
D-72074杜宾根
www.zopyx.com

发行说明

0.3.7(2019/04/29)

  • 固定测试套件 [阿琼]

0.3.6(2019/04/29)

  • 支持webdavs://opener协议 [阿琼]

0.3.5(2018/08/06)

  • 修复了由于强 入住fs>;2.0.27

0.3.4(2018/04/16)

  • 合并的pr_14(openbin不提升ResourceNotFoundon 缺少父项) [阿琼,阿尔托诺斯]

0.3.3(2017/12/29)

  • 修复了opener.py中硬编码http方法的问题 [阿琼]

0.3.2(2017/11/13)

  • 详细信息/修改+详细信息/创建是根据 到pyfilesystem2文档的最新时间 [阿琼]

0.3.1(2017/10/19)

  • 固定许可文件(MIT)

0.3.0(2017/10/16)

0.2.0(2017/05/04)

  • 使用Docker Images的Travis上的新测试基础设施 使用python 2.7-3.6进行测试

0.1.0(2017/04/10)

  • 初始版本

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
解释java选择方法   连接到127.0.0.1的java间歇性故障,连接到IP(eth0)时没有故障   java如何优雅地杀死hadoop作业/intercept`hadoop作业杀死`   java如何通过引导类加载器以编程方式加载另一个类?   url Java:在查询参数之前使用片段构建URI   在BroadLeaf表blc_order_属性中保存OrderAttributes值时发生java错误   安卓将功能从xml转换为java   java如何将数据写入文件?   java JPA SQL结果映射   Java中整数对象比较运算符的引用安全性   Spring测试失败:java。lang.NoClassDefFoundError:org/springframework/cglib/transform/impl/memorysafuendecaredthrowableStrategy   rich:extendedDataTable中的java行选择和数据处理   java为什么我需要在volatile上对多个线程使用synchronized?   java尽管构建成功,但为什么会出现此错误?   数组$ArrayList不能转换为java。util。java中的ArrayList   java如何根据泛型类型调用方法?   java将JLabel添加到JPanel,将JPanel添加到JFrame   如果MapStruct中的源为null,则java将父目标设置为null   JavaJBossDrools从DRL插入事实   java不同的JRE安装(windows)